How much does it cost to rent a charter bus from Bus.com?

The cost of your charter bus depends on a variety of factors, such as the amount of time you will require the bus for, as well as the vehicle type and number of vehicles. Use Bus.com online booking tool to get an idea of the potential costs or reach out to our 24/7 booking support specialists. Your price will include the driver’s time, industry-standard tip (if applicable), accommodations (if applicable), and taxes.

Benefits of construction bus rentals

There is a lot of heavy machinery involved in construction, and chaotic traffic, unplanned arrivals, or careless parking can cause significant delays and safety hazards. A well-designed traffic management plan can help minimize congestion, safety risks, and other work zone challenges. Using charter buses to deliver your workforce may prevent many problems, including:

  • Buses require fewer parking spaces compared to a fleet of cars.
  • To minimize disruption to the neighborhood, workers can arrive at low-volume times
  • Bus shuttles can help avoid creating long lines of cars waiting to enter and park
  • Vehicle movement and parking around the site can be minimized as much as possible with a charter bus
  • Fewer vehicles helps the surrounding area become safer for cyclists and pedestrians
